Do be careful with herbals - some can be quite strong/reactive. If your symptoms concern you (and they *would* concern me), I would back off and try ONE herbal at time to see if a formula or combination is problematic for you.
And I think that you must have seen a holistic physician - not a homeopath. Homeopaths prescribe homeopathic remedies, not herbs.
Just be careful with the herbal formulas - you can be allergic to something in them and not know it. For example, if I take anything with ginkgo in it, I get really angry - it's a sensitivity I have to ginkgo. My mom can't take anything with cinnamon in it or she gets short of breath (not cool).
What you're taking may be making you herx or it could be an allergic reaction - please be careful.
